2 lbs. Kielbasa, cut into pieces
1-1/2 lbs. baby red potatoes
4 C. water
1 Bay leaves
Place all ingredients into cooking pot and place lid on cooker and lock it. Set
regulator knob to PRESSURE. Press the HIGH pressure function for 15 minutes.
Press start, the floating valve will rise when cooking pressure is reached and timer
will begin to countdown.
When finished, press STOP button and use the quick release method to release the
pressure by turning the regulator knob to STEAM in short bursts.
